Subdomains separate from Site.com?
Hi All,
We are in the process of building out a new public facing internet site using Site.com CMS system.
Our existing site consists of a hybrid of public facing content and customer applications spread across subdomains.
If we deploy our www.<ourdomain>.com to Site.com, would we still be able to host our own custom applications on any of our subdomains (outside of Site.com) (e.g. apps.<ourdomain>.com) ?

Hi Yuri,
I don't see why you couldn't set the DNS records to point to another server/IP as usual.
Laura
Yes you would - you have complete control over your DNS and domain names.
A common situation is that you'd have several sites customers.mysite.com, www.mysite.com, and internal.mysite.com. Each could be hosted on a totally different technology stack (Site.com, Heroku, Amazon, etc.)
